Crowdfunding campaign launched to support Bridgman courtyard project

A crowdfunding campaign has been launched for an improvement project in Bridgman. The Greater Bridgman Area Chamber and Growth Alliance’s Tara Heiser tells us they’re looking to spruce up the Bridgman Courtyard, a space on Lake Street, for community gatherings. The courtyard was started in 2020 as a way for people to get together safely outdoors. Right now, it features seating, tables, and umbrellas. They’re planning to add more.

“It will be a wooden pergola structure with bistro lights hanging from it, and they’re also bring in a new electrical source, and then we’ll be pouring all new concrete because the structure need to be pretty far deep into the ground to ensure its safety and longevity,” Heiser said.

Heiser says they’ll also work with Bridgman High School art students to paint a mural on the ground when the new pavement is in. So far, a summer concert series has been held at the courtyard, and she says even more could be done if the crowdfunding campaign is successful. The Michigan Economic Development Corporation will match up to $50,000 raised, meaning if the $50,000 campaign is successful, the project will have $100,000.
